C-69, Greater Kailash, , Delhi - 110048, Delhi, India
16/804, East End Apt, Mayur Vihar Phase I, , Delhi - 110091, Delhi, India
Dda Sport Cplx, Tahirpur, , Delhi - 110095, Delhi, India
Safdarjung Enclave, , Delhi - 110029, Delhi, India
Sarvapriya Vihar, , Delhi - 110016, Delhi, India